Output 597bb5b9377681e87d1a72f1bed3cc2df5d145d306b60d814d4ab8abd36f5d7f:0

value
490000
script pubkey
OP_0 OP_PUSHBYTES_20 b89158fbbd31e4fe8422752d2bac4c55eb2886e3
address
bc1qhzg437aax8j0appzw5kjhtzv2h4j3phrjaspwy
transaction
597bb5b9377681e87d1a72f1bed3cc2df5d145d306b60d814d4ab8abd36f5d7f
confirmations
140312
spent
true